METHOD OF FORMING A CERAMIC PRODUCT |
摘要 |
Ceramic materials which comprise a transition metal carbide, nitride or carbonitride and from 5 to 90 volume percent zirconia. In general, these materials have a bulk density greater than 75 percent of theoretical and a modulus of rupture greater than 200 MPa. The materials may be formed by mixing together a finely divided particulate transition metal carbide, nitride or carbonitride and zirconia, fabricating the mixture into a ceramic product of the desired shape, and heating the fabricated mixture in a low oxygen containing atmosphere to a temperature in the range from 1300<o>C to 2000<o>C to produce the ceramic product. |
